  • removing pulldown from 59.94 video

    Posted by Uli Kunkel on January 10, 2006 at 9:44 am

    I have captured footaged through a KONA LHe from the component out of JVC’s HDV deck. The 720p24 footage is wrapped in a 60p wrapper to maintain a cadence that FCP will support. As I am finishing to film, the lab said that I could use Cinema tools to remove the pulldown on the 24p video. I have tried this and get a message saying: “Error: video does not contain an NTSC frame rate.”

    Is the lab mistaken or am I doing something wrong here?
